Mental health professionals such as psychiatrists, psychologists, and social workers can help people cope with depression. What do psychiatrists do?

They study behavior and emotions and practice psychotherapy with individuals or groups, but they cannot prescribe medications.
They work with family members of someone being treated for mental disorders, and may also work as individual or group counselors.
They diagnose and treat mental disorders by conducting exams, ordering and interpreting tests, and prescribing medications.

Psychiatrists help people with mental, emotional, and behavioral disorders. They also help patients and their families cope with any stress and crises.
